RA
Itz_Rafin
Rafin Azim · Portfolio
Initializing 0%
Profile Image

Hey there!, Myself

Rafin Azim

And I'm a

I build web and software projects. Passionate about learning new technologies and turning ideas into real solutions.

Download Resume

About Me

Computer Science Student & Aspiring Developer

I'm currently pursuing my B.Sc. in Computer Science and Engineering from University of Asia Pacific, where I'm building a strong foundation in algorithms, data structures, and software development principles.

With a solid foundation in Java OOP, Python, and C, I enjoy diving deep into software engineering principles. I am continuously learning new technologies to build scalable and impactful applications that improve lives.

View My Skills
About Image
Academic Journey

My Education

2020 — 2022 Completed

Higher Secondary Certificate (HSC)

Begum Badrunnesa Govt. Girls' College

Completed Higher Secondary Education in Science group

Science Group
2018 — 2020 Completed

Secondary School Certificate (SSC)

Keraniganj Girls School and College

Completed Secondary Education with distinction

Science Group
SSC
HSC
Bachelor's
Graduation

My Skills

Here are the languages I've learned and worked with during my first 2 years of university.

Python

Object-oriented programming, data structures, and problem solving. Strong foundation in Python basics and OOP concepts.

Proficiency 85%

Java OOP

Core Java with focus on object-oriented programming, classes, inheritance, polymorphism, and encapsulation.

Proficiency 80%

C Programming

Procedural programming, memory management, pointers, and data structures implementation.

Proficiency 75%

HTML & CSS

Responsive web design, flexbox, grid, and modern CSS. Building clean and structured web interfaces.

Proficiency 70%

Django

Currently learning Django framework. Building backend web applications with Python.

Proficiency 20%

My Projects

These are the small backend projects I've built during my first 2 years of university. Each project demonstrates core computer science concepts I learned in the classroom — OOP, data structures, file handling, and API integration.

Weather App

Python PyQt5 API JSON

Desktop weather application with GUI. Fetches real-time weather data from OpenWeatherMap API. Displays temperature, conditions, and weather emojis. Handles 15+ error cases including network issues and invalid cities.

View Code

Stop Watch

Python PyQt5 GUI Timer

Professional stopwatch application with milliseconds precision. Features Start, Stop, Reset controls and custom pink-themed UI. Updates every 10ms.

View Code

Alarm Clock

Python CLI Time Module Winsound

Command-line alarm clock. Takes user input time (HH:MM:SS), displays real-time clock updating every second, and triggers beep sound when alarm matches. Simple, lightweight, and functional.

View Code

Airline Reservation System

Java OOP File I/O Collections

Complete backend airline reservation system. Implements flight management, passenger registration, seat booking/cancellation, and file-based data persistence. Demonstrates encapsulation, inheritance, polymorphism, and exception handling.

View Code

Student Record System

C Linked Lists File Handling

Dynamic memory allocation with linked lists for student records. Features add, delete, search, update, and display operations with persistent file storage.

View Code

Portfolio Website

HTML5 CSS3 JavaScript Responsive

Responsive personal portfolio website showcasing skills, projects, and contact information. Features smooth scrolling, mobile-friendly design, and interactive elements.

View Code
View All Projects on GitHub

Get in Touch

RA
Rafin Azim AI
Ask me anything about myself!
Hey! 👋 I'm Rafin. Ask me anything — my skills, projects, education, or how to reach me!
Just now